Emily's legal career commenced with a strong foundation in research and litigation. She served as a law clerk to the Honorable Eliot D. Prescott at the Connecticut Appellate Court in Hartford, honing her skills in appellate advocacy and legal analysis. Prior to her clerkship, she gained invaluable experience as a research clerk for trial-level judges in the Connecticut Superior Court. In this role, she distinguished herself as a criminal law specialist within the Connecticut Judicial Branch’s Legal Research Office, providing critical insights and support on complex legal issues to judges and co-clerks. Her practical experience is further enhanced by her internships at prestigious institutions, including the United States Attorney’s Office, the Office of the Corporation Counsel for the City of New Haven, and the State’s Attorney’s Office. Additionally, as a participant in the Quinnipiac Civil Justice Clinic, she represented a client in an appeal before the Connecticut Department of Labor, showcasing her dedication to serving those in need.
